2023-24 NFL Week 18 playoff scenarios: Packers, Bills, Steelers clinch berths
The Jacksonville Jaguars lost to the Tennessee Titans on Sunday setting off some AFC playoff dominoes. The Pittsburgh Steelers and Buffalo Bills clinched playoff spots with the Jags’ loss. This also gave the Houston Texans the AFC South title.
And later, the Bills gained the AFC East title by beating the Miami Dolphins on Sunday night.

Plus, the Tampa Bay Buccaneers punched their ticket to the postseason capturing the NFC South crown with a sluggish win over the Carolina Panthers on Sunday. And the Green Bay Packers grabbed the last remaining NFC wild card berth by beating the Chicago Bears.
Below is a glimpse at all the scenarios for every team with playoff life remaining.

AFC
Clinched
- Baltimore Ravens (13-4) — AFC North division title, No. 1 seed, first-round bye and home-field advantage
- Buffalo Bills (11-6) — AFC East division title
- Kansas City Chiefs (11-6) — AFC West division title
- Houston Texans (10-7) — AFC South division title
- Cleveland Browns (11-6) — playoff berth
- Miami Dolphins (11-6) — playoff berth
- Pittsburgh Steelers (10-7) — playoff berth

NFC
Clinched
- San Francisco 49ers (12-4) — NFC West division title, No. 1 seed, first-round bye and home-field advantage
- Dallas Cowboys (12-5) — NFC East division title
- Detroit Lions (12-5) — NFC North division title
- Tampa Bay Buccaneers (9-8) — NFC South division title
- Philadelphia Eagles (11-6) — playoff berth
- Los Angeles Rams (10-7) — playoff berth
- Green Bay Packers (9-8) — playoff berth
